The GCC Smart Homes Market is experiencing rapid growth as the Gulf Cooperation Council countries increasingly embrace digital transformation and smart living technologies. Smart homes utilize interconnected devices such as smart lighting, security systems, thermostats, appliances, and voice assistants that can be controlled remotely through smartphones or centralized platforms. These technologies enhance convenience, improve energy efficiency, and strengthen residential security.

The GCC region, which includes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ates, Qatar, Kuwait, Bahrain, and Oman, has become one of the fastest-growing markets for smart home technologies in the Middle East. Rising urbanization, strong government initiatives supporting digital infrastructure, and high disposable incomes are encouraging the adoption of connected home devices across the region.

 

Smart home technologies are becoming increasingly popular in modern residential developments, luxury apartments, and smart city projects across GCC countries. Real estate developers are integrating smart home solutions as part of premium housing offerings, enabling residents to control lighting, climate systems, entertainment devices, and security features through a unified digital platform. As a result, the GCC smart homes market is expected to expand significantly over the next decade.

Technology Trends Shaping the Market

Technological innovation is transforming the GCC smart homes market, with several emerging trends influencing the development of connected living environments.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, and advanced connectivity technologies are enhancing the functionality and performance of smart home systems.

Artificial intelligence plays an increasingly important role in modern smart homes. AI-powered systems analyze user behavior and automatically adjust settings to optimize comfort and efficiency. For example, AI-enabled thermostats can learn residents’ daily routines and regulate indoor temperatures accordingly.

Another significant trend is the integration of voice-controlled ecosystems. Voice assistants serve as central hubs that connect various smart devices within a home. Users can control lighting, entertainment systems, and security devices using simple voice commands, improving the overall user experience.

The adoption of wireless communication technologies such as Wi-Fi, Zigbee, Bluetooth, and Z-Wave is also expanding in the GCC region. These technologies allow seamless communication between devices and simplify the installation of smart home systems.

Cloud-based platforms are further enhancing smart home functionality by enabling remote access, data storage, and real-time monitoring. Homeowners can manage their smart home systems from anywhere using mobile applications connected to cloud servers.

Another emerging trend is the integration of smart home technologies with renewable energy systems. Solar panels and energy storage solutions can be connected to smart home platforms, allowing homeowners to monitor and optimize energy consumption.

Market Segmentation

The GCC smart homes market can be segmented based on product type, technology, application, and distribution channel. Each segment contributes to the overall expansion of the smart home ecosystem in the region.

By product type, the market includes security and access control systems, lighting control systems, HVAC control systems, smart appliances, entertainment systems, and home healthcare devices. Among these segments, security and access control solutions represent a major share of the market due to rising demand for residential safety technologies.

Lighting control systems are also gaining popularity as homeowners seek to automate lighting schedules and reduce electricity consumption. Smart lighting solutions allow users to control brightness, color, and timing through mobile applications or voice commands.

By technology, the market is divided into wired and wireless smart home solutions. Wireless technologies dominate the market due to their ease of installation and compatibility with multiple devices.

By application, the residential sector accounts for the largest share of the GCC smart homes market. However, commercial applications such as hotels, offices, and serviced apartments are increasingly adopting smart automation technologies to improve operational efficiency and enhance customer experiences.

Distribution channels include online retail platforms, electronics stores, home improvement retailers, and specialized smart home solution providers. E-commerce platforms are becoming an important channel for purchasing smart devices due to their convenience and competitive pricing.

Competitive Landscape

The GCC smart homes market is highly competitive, with both global technology companies and regional service providers offering smart home solutions. Leading companies in the market provide a wide range of devices and integrated platforms designed to support home automation systems.

Major global players operating in the GCC smart homes market include Amazon, Google, Apple, Samsung, Honeywell, Siemens, Schneider Electric, and Philips. These companies offer products such as smart speakers, lighting systems, thermostats, and security devices that form the core of smart home ecosystems.

Telecommunication companies in the GCC region are also playing a significant role in the market. Many telecom providers offer smart home services bundled with internet and communication packages, making it easier for consumers to adopt connected home technologies.

Real estate developers are another important participant in the market. Many new residential projects incorporate smart home infrastructure as part of premium housing offerings. Developers collaborate with technology providers to integrate automation systems during construction.

Local system integrators and installation service providers also contribute to the market by offering customized smart home solutions, installation services, and technical support.

Challenges in the Market

Despite strong growth potential, the GCC smart homes market faces several challenges that may affect adoption rates. One of the main challenges is the high initial cost associated with advanced smart home systems. Installing a fully automated smart home can require significant investment, particularly in luxury residential properties.

Another challenge is cybersecurity concerns. As homes become increasingly connected, they may become vulnerable to cyber threats and unauthorized access. Ensuring secure communication between devices and protecting user data are critical priorities for smart home technology providers.

Interoperability issues between devices from different manufacturers can also create challenges for system integration. Different communication protocols and software platforms may limit compatibility between devices.

Additionally, consumer awareness remains limited in some parts of the region. While adoption rates are high in major cities, some households are still unfamiliar with the benefits and capabilities of smart home technologies. Increasing awareness through marketing and education initiatives will be essential for market expansion.
